Turchin Center for the Visual Arts
Located on the campus of Appalachian State University, the Turchin Center for the Visual Arts is the largest visual arts center in western North Carolina. The gallery features rotating exhibitions from regional, national, and international artists while highlighting the creative spirit of the Appalachian Mountains.

Experience Live Appalachian Music
Music has always been woven into the fabric of Appalachian culture. Bluegrass, old-time, folk, and Americana music continue to thrive throughout Boone, making it one of the best places in North Carolina to enjoy live performances.
The Jones House Cultural & Community Center
One of Boone's most beloved cultural landmarks, The Jones House hosts free summer concerts, traditional mountain music, bluegrass performances, jam sessions, and community events throughout the year. It's a must-visit for anyone looking to experience authentic Appalachian music.

Step Into Appalachian History
Learning about Appalachian culture also means exploring the history that shaped the High Country.
Hickory Ridge History Museum
Located next to the Horn in the West outdoor drama, Hickory Ridge History Museum offers visitors a glimpse into life in the Appalachian Mountains during the late 1700s. Historic cabins, live demonstrations, and costumed interpreters showcase traditional crafts, cooking, blacksmithing, and daily life from generations past.
It's one of Boone's most unique attractions and a favorite for families, history lovers, and anyone interested in Appalachian heritage.
